B站UE4开发工程师一面面经

投了一个半月了,之前显示初筛未通过,不知道怎么给我捞起来了,难不成是最近朝夕光年裁员B站反而要扩招了?还是说今年秋招KPI还差了点拉起来刷个KPI。

用的牛客面试,开场无自我介绍。直接开始问技术问题,最开始问两三个C++八股,比如new/delete、malloc/free的区别。有的我熟悉一点,答得多一点,有的就只讲了皮毛。此部分大概5分钟就结束。

然后我简历写的虚幻开发项目比较多,写的技能点比较全,因此问UE的问题占了大头。

最开始先问我什么情况下会用C++。我U++(虚幻C++的笑称)只能算入门,因此答我在蓝图解决问题繁复的时候会用C++,主要用蓝图。

后面问了一堆动画的问题,比如sequencer的运用程度、自己开发一个sequencer的话会怎么开发、状态机的理解、动画里pose的知识(没太听清,大概是pose?)、性能优化、矩阵的运算(左乘右乘)、坐标的转换,问了大概有15分钟。

然后就是对于项目的提问,关于我自己做的项目,pixelstreaming是什么、VR和传统游戏的区别,项目的介绍、对于哪个项目印象比较深刻、觉得可以拿出手。此部分大概5-10分钟。

后面反问环节,问面试流程,答3技术面1HR面(四轮面试吗?那感觉第一轮炮灰应该不少)问用蓝图多还是用C++多,答用C++多(听到这里感觉凉了半截,他都没问C++,大概率是嗝屁了)主要开发会用到哪个模块,答主要动画模块比较多这部分5分钟左右

总体流程只有半小时。面试官给我的印象算是比较好的,没有那种咄咄逼人的感觉,说话还算平和。

全部评论
慎重啊!在b站做游戏和在字节做游戏下场都类似啊!劝君郑重!
点赞 回复 分享
发布于 2023-11-29 20:39 广东

相关推荐

5月9日  西安小公司(20——99)  嵌入式开发  一面:面试官问题:一、首先做一下自我介绍二、讲一下项目中标明的存储优化三、会画板子吗四、学过数电、模电吗五、单片机的最小系统六、项目中的板子是自己画的吗七、以后打算在西安工作吗自我不足:一、自我介绍要准备一下,尽量简短,然后可以说一下自己擅长的技术,把面试官后面的问题,往这些技术上去引入二、对自己标明的掌握的技能一定要了解,你说过设计,画板,焊接过最小系统板,但是连单片机的最小系统都回答不上来三、在面试前一定要提前将自己的项目介绍要用嘴巴练习一遍,如果没有经过练习,你想的和你说的,完全是两码事,脑袋会宕机,说起来卡顿,然后词语可能用的也不是特别恰当,没办法将自己的项目亮点让面试官看到四、一定要自信,技术很广阔,你会的不一定面试官就会,不要觉得自己低人一等,而且有的时候,他要求的和他实际做的是两码事。你之前自己画过PCB,就说自己会PCB(根据数据手册中的推荐电路,设计PCB板),你进这些小公司最多就是抄板,没有什么技术含量,而且你是一个实习生,不会让你做太核心的业务,老板也怕出问题。五、在面试之前,要详细看一下招聘,要求然后心里就有底了,知道他画板加软件一条龙,就说自己都会,本来自己也会,只是没有经常使用画板罢了。六、在面试的期间,插入自己的过往经历,表达对这方面的兴趣,你对这方面的热爱,比如高中就参加过机器人竞赛,大一大二,绘制过PCB(可调电源、数码管时钟)然后焊接成功运行至今七、补充一下校园经历:电子社团软件部负责人,教授大一大二学生,单片机的知识。然后与同学合作的项目啊,都是优秀的巴拉巴拉(六、七)两点应该加到自我介绍中。
查看7道真题和解析 面试经验谈 面试问题记录
点赞 评论 收藏
分享
评论
点赞
8
分享

创作者周榜

更多
牛客网
牛客企业服务